The Attendance Report allows administrators to track student attendance by activities completed or time spent in each course over custom date ranges, viewable daily, weekly, or for the entire range. Users can set thresholds for minimum activities or time, choose if students must meet both or either, and customize the report to show IDs or activity details. Reports can be reviewed in Pearson Connexus or downloaded as CSV files for further analysis.
Access the Report and Define the Data
- From the Main Menu, select Attendance Report.
Within the report, you can select to:
- Verify current domain or change to view a different domain (pencil icon). The report automatically defaults to the domain you are in when the report is opened.
- Select to view attendance by:
- Entire range (one result for the whole span)
- Weekly (one column per full week from your start date)
- Daily (one column per selected weekday)
- Provide a start and end date for the attendance data.
- If you chose Weekly, read the hint under the dates. The tool may shift the end date forward to cover only whole weeks.
- If you chose Daily, use Days to evaluate to tick Sun–Sat. If you leave them all unchecked, the tool uses Monday–Friday.
- Enter thresholds for attendance (at least one is required):
- Minimum activities (both gradable and non-gradable) completed
- Minimum time spent (minutes) (active course time on an activity)
- If both thresholds are set, you can select if:
- Student must meet both
- Student may meet either
- Generate the report to analyze attendance for the settings selected.
View the Report
There are two options for viewing report data after it is generated:
- Review attendance data within Pearson Connexus.
- Download the report as a CSV file to analyze further in Excel.
Note: A negative number under "activity details" indicates that there are fewer activities than last time which is the result of graded activities being deleted from the course.
Customize the Report- Optional
- Select Show IDs to display Enrollment IDs, User IDs, and Course IDs.
- Select Show activity details (counts per date range) to display attendance details for activities and minutes completed during the date range specified.
Note: Choosing one or both options will update the data shown in the Pearson Connexus view and when downloading the CSV report.
